November 2018 Fellowship Buzz: Upcoming Deadlines to Know
Primary tabs
If you're a graduate student in the market for a fellowship, read on to find out more about upcoming opportunities.
- GEM Fellowship (Graduate Engineering Degrees for Minorities)
Deadline: Nov. 13 -
U.S. Department of Energy’s Office of Science Graduate Student Research Fellowship Program
Deadline: Nov. 15 -
Postdoctoral Fellowships at Sandia Laboratories
All awards reserved for U.S. citizens. The Von Neumann Fellowship is reserved for those with a Ph.D. in applied or computational mathematics.
Deadline: Nov. 26 -
Environmental Defense Fund Climate Corps Fellowship
Deadline for first-round offer consideration: Dec. 3
Deadline for all applicants: Jan. 7, 2019 -
National Defense Science and Engineering Graduate Fellowship
Deadline: Dec. 7 -
National Physical Science Consortium: Graduate Fellowships in Science, Mathematics, and Engineering
Awards reserved for U.S. citizens.
Deadline: Dec. 8 -
Ford Foundation Fellowship Programs
Postdoctoral Fellowship deadline: Dec. 13
Dissertation Fellowship deadline: Jan. 8, 2019 -
P.E.O. International Peace Scholarship
Deadline/Special Note: Eligibility must be established before application material is sent to applicants. The completed eligibility form will be accepted electronically in the IPS office through Dec. 15. -
Chateaubriand Fellowship Program
Deadline: Jan. 8, 2019 -
Winter Data Science Fellowship Opportunity
Awards reserved for those within one year of obtaining or have already obtained a master's or Ph.D. degree.
Deadline: Jan. 7-March 1, 2019
